Church / Chapel Name: Stadtkirche St. Nikolai
Font Location in Church: [disappeared?]
Church Patron Saint(s): St. Nicholas of Myra
Church Notes: church originally of the 13thC; re-building started in 1400 but not completed until 1570; damaged in Thirty-year War; re-built in 1688; destroyed by fire in 1752; re-buil; damaged in WWII; restored in the 1950s, and again in the 1990s
